The Milling Process Definitions Cutting speedv c Indicates the surface speed at which the cutting edge machines the workpiece. Effective or true cutting speed v e Indicates the surface speed at the effective diameter DC ap.This value is necessary for determining the true cutting data at the actual depth of cut a p.This is a particularly important value when using round insert cutters

2004-10-13Equation 1 is multiplied by the factor of 1.08. A multi-compartment ball mill consists of two or more grate discharge ball mills in series. The same equation is used to calculate the power that each ball mill compartment should draw. The total power is the sum of the power calculated for each of the separate compartments
